    US retail giant Target says up to 70 million customers had payment card and personal data stolen from the company's databases in December - 30 million more that it first thought.Target said the thieves took credit card numbers, names, postal addresses, phone numbers and email addresses.
    The data breach began on or around 29 November, known as Black Friday, one of the busiest shopping days of the year.
    The company said customers would have "zero liability" for any fraud losses.
    But this hasn't stopped some customers suing Target, claiming that Target failed to notify them of the breach before it was first reported and did not "maintain reasonable security procedures" to prevent the attack.
    "I know that it is frustrating for our guests to learn that this information was taken and we are truly sorry they are having to endure this," said Gregg Steinhafel, Target's chairman, president and chief executive officer.
    Target is offering one year of free credit monitoring and iden y theft protection to all its US customers.

    Target's data breach is much broader than once believed.The nationwide retailer on Friday announced that personal information on as many as 70 million additional customers was stolen as part of the company's payment card data breach. The information stolen includes names, mailing addresses, phone numbers, and e-mail addresses, the company said.
    While Target spokesperson Molly Snyder said that there could be some overlap with the approximately 40 million people first said to be affected by the breach in December, the new total of people impacted by the breach could be as high as 110 million.
    "I know that it is frustrating for our guests to learn that this information was taken and we are truly sorry they are having to endure this," Gregg Steinhafel, chairman, president and chief executive officer at Target, said in a statement. "I also want our guests to know that understanding and sharing the facts related to this incident is important to me and the entire Target team.
